Refreshing Strawberry-Mandarin Asian Fusion Salad
This Refreshing Strawberry-Mandarin Asian Fusion Salad is a vibrant and delicious blend of fresh ingredients that perfectly balances sweet and savory flavors. Bursting with juicy strawberries and zesty mandarins, this salad is elevated with crunchy chow mein noodles and slivered almonds, making it an irresistible appetizer or side dish. Whip it up for a romantic dinner or serve it as a main course with grilled chicken for a hearty and satisfying meal. Perfect for warm weather, gatherings, or any occasion where a fresh and light dish is desired!

Ingredients

Romaine lettuce 6 cups (chopped)
Strawberries 1 cup (sliced)
Mandarin oranges 1 cup (drained)
Chow mein noodles 3/4 cup (crunchy)
Slivered almonds 3 tablespoons (raw)
Light balsamic vinaigrette 1/2 cup (dressing)

Instructions

1
In a large salad bowl, combine the chopped romaine lettuce, sliced strawberries, and drained mandarin oranges.
2
Sprinkle the chow mein noodles and slivered almonds evenly over the top.
3
Drizzle the light balsamic vinaigrette dressing over the salad ingredients.
4
Toss everything gently but thoroughly to ensure all the ingredients are coated with the dressing.
5
Serve immediately as a refreshing side salad, or add grilled chicken to make it a delicious main dish.
